struct DotToLinalgGeneric
|
|
: public ::mlir::OpRewritePattern<mlir::concretelang::FHELinalg::Dot> {
|
|
DotToLinalgGeneric(::mlir::MLIRContext *context)
|
|
: ::mlir::OpRewritePattern<::mlir::concretelang::FHELinalg::Dot>(
|
|
context, mlir::concretelang::DEFAULT_PATTERN_BENEFIT) {}
|
|
|
|
// This rewrite pattern transforms any instance of
|
|
// `FHELinalg.dot_eint_int` to an instance of `linalg.generic` with an
|
|
// appropriate region using `FHE.mul_eint_int` and
|
|
// `FHE.add_eint` operations, an appropriate specification for the
|
|
// iteration dimensions and appropriate operations managing the
|
|
// accumulator of `linalg.generic`.
|
|
//
|
|
// Example:
|
|
//
|
|
// %o = "FHELinalg.dot_eint_int"(%arg0, %arg1) :
|
|
// (tensor<4x!FHE.eint<0>>,
|
|
// tensor<4xi32>) -> (!FHE.eint<0>)
|
|
//
|
|
// becomes:
|
|
//
|
|
// %0 = "FHE.zero_tensor"() : () -> tensor<1x!FHE.eint<0>>
|
|
// %1 = linalg.generic {
|
|
// indexing_maps = [#map0, #map0, #map1],
|
|
// iterator_types = ["reduction"]
|
|
// }
|
|
// ins(%arg0, %arg1 : tensor<2x!FHE.eint<0>>, tensor<2xi32>)
|
|
// outs(%0 : tensor<1x!FHE.eint<0>>) {
|
|
// ^bb0(%arg2: !FHE.eint<0>, %arg3: i32, %arg4: !FHE.eint<0>):
|
|
// %4 = "FHE.mul_eint_int"(%arg2, %arg3) :
|
|
// (!FHE.eint<0>, i32) -> !FHE.eint<0>
|
|
//
|
|
// %5 = "FHE.add_eint"(%4, %arg4) :
|
|
// (!FHE.eint<0>, !FHE.eint<0>) -> !FHE.eint<0>
|
|
//
|
|
// linalg.yield %5 : !FHE.eint<0>
|
|
// } -> tensor<1x!FHE.eint<0>>
|
|
//
|
|
// %c0 = constant 0 : index
|
|
// %o = tensor.extract %1[%c0] : tensor<1x!FHE.eint<0>>
|
|
//
|
|
::mlir::LogicalResult
|
|
matchAndRewrite(::mlir::concretelang::FHELinalg::Dot dotOp,
|
|
::mlir::PatternRewriter &rewriter) const override {
|
|
|
|
auto zeroTensorOp = rewriter.create<mlir::concretelang::FHE::ZeroTensorOp>(
|
|
dotOp.getLoc(), mlir::RankedTensorType::get({1}, dotOp.getType()));
|
|
|
|
// Create `linalg.generic` op
|
|
llvm::SmallVector<mlir::Type, 1> resTypes{zeroTensorOp.getType()};
|
|
llvm::SmallVector<mlir::Value, 2> ins{dotOp.lhs(), dotOp.rhs()};
|
|
llvm::SmallVector<mlir::Value, 1> outs{zeroTensorOp};
|
|
llvm::SmallVector<mlir::AffineMap, 3> maps{
|
|
mlir::AffineMap::getMultiDimIdentityMap(1, this->getContext()),
|
|
mlir::AffineMap::getMultiDimIdentityMap(1, this->getContext()),
|
|
mlir::AffineMap::get(1, 0, {rewriter.getAffineConstantExpr(0)},
|
|
this->getContext())};
|
|
|
|
llvm::SmallVector<llvm::StringRef, 1> itTypes{"reduction"};
|
|
llvm::StringRef doc{""};
|
|
llvm::StringRef call{""};
|
|
|
|
auto regBuilder = [&](mlir::OpBuilder &nestedBuilder,
|
|
mlir::Location nestedLoc,
|
|
mlir::ValueRange blockArgs) {
|
|
mlir::concretelang::FHE::MulEintIntOp mul =
|
|
nestedBuilder.create<mlir::concretelang::FHE::MulEintIntOp>(
|
|
dotOp.getLoc(), blockArgs[0], blockArgs[1]);
|
|
mlir::concretelang::FHE::AddEintOp add =
|
|
nestedBuilder.create<mlir::concretelang::FHE::AddEintOp>(
|
|
dotOp.getLoc(), mul, blockArgs[2]);
|
|
|
|
nestedBuilder.create<mlir::linalg::YieldOp>(dotOp.getLoc(),
|
|
add.getResult());
|
|
};
|
|
|
|
mlir::linalg::GenericOp gop = rewriter.create<mlir::linalg::GenericOp>(
|
|
dotOp.getLoc(), resTypes, ins, outs, maps, itTypes, doc, call,
|
|
regBuilder);
|
|
|
|
// Return value is still a 1-dimensional tensor; extract first
|
|
// element and use it as a replacement for the result of the dot
|
|
// operation
|
|
mlir::Value idx0 =
|
|
rewriter.create<mlir::arith::ConstantIndexOp>(dotOp.getLoc(), 0);
|
|
llvm::SmallVector<mlir::Value, 1> indexes{idx0};
|
|
mlir::Value res = rewriter.create<mlir::tensor::ExtractOp>(
|
|
dotOp.getLoc(), gop.getResult(0), indexes);
|
|
|
|
rewriter.replaceOp(dotOp, {res});
|
|
|
|
return ::mlir::success();
|
|
};
|
|
};

// This rewrite pattern transforms any instance of operators
|
|
// `FHELinalg.concat` to instances of `tensor.insert_slice`
|
|
//
|
|
// Example:
|
|
//
|
|
// %result = "FHELinalg.concat"(%x, %y) { axis = 1 } :
|
|
// (tensor<2x3x!FHE.eint<4>>, tensor<2x4x!FHE.eint<4>>)
|
|
// -> tensor<2x7x!FHE.eint<4>>
|
|
//
|
|
// becomes:
|
|
//
|
|
// %empty = "FHE.zero_tensor"() : () -> tensor<2x7x!FHE.eint<4>>
|
|
//
|
|
// %x_copied = tensor.insert_slice %x into %empty[0, 0] [2, 3] [1, 1]
|
|
// : tensor<2x3x!FHE.eint<4>> into tensor<2x7x!FHE.eint<4>>
|
|
//
|
|
// %y_copied = tensor.insert_slice %y into %x_copied[0, 3] [2, 4] [1, 1]
|
|
// : tensor<2x4x!FHE.eint<4>> into tensor<2x7x!FHE.eint<4>>
|
|
//
|
|
struct ConcatRewritePattern
|
|
: public mlir::OpRewritePattern<FHELinalg::ConcatOp> {
|
|
ConcatRewritePattern(mlir::MLIRContext *context)
|
|
: mlir::OpRewritePattern<FHELinalg::ConcatOp>(
|
|
context, mlir::concretelang::DEFAULT_PATTERN_BENEFIT) {}
|
|
|
|
mlir::LogicalResult
|
|
matchAndRewrite(FHELinalg::ConcatOp op,
|
|
mlir::PatternRewriter &rewriter) const override {
|
|
|
|
mlir::Location location = op.getLoc();
|
|
size_t axis = op.axis();
|
|
|
|
mlir::Value output = op.getResult();
|
|
auto outputType = output.getType().dyn_cast<mlir::TensorType>();
|
|
|
|
llvm::ArrayRef<int64_t> outputShape = outputType.getShape();
|
|
size_t outputDimensions = outputShape.size();
|
|
|
|
mlir::Value result =
|
|
rewriter.create<FHE::ZeroTensorOp>(location, outputType).getResult();
|
|
|
|
auto offsets = llvm::SmallVector<int64_t, 3>{};
|
|
auto sizes = llvm::SmallVector<int64_t, 3>{};
|
|
auto strides = llvm::SmallVector<int64_t, 3>{};
|
|
|
|
// set up the initial values of offsets, sizes, and strides
|
|
// each one has exactly `outputDimensions` number of elements
|
|
// - offsets will be [0, 0, 0, ..., 0, 0, 0]
|
|
// - strides will be [1, 1, 1, ..., 1, 1, 1]
|
|
// - sizes will be the output shape except at the 'axis' which will be 0
|
|
for (size_t i = 0; i < outputDimensions; i++) {
|
|
offsets.push_back(0);
|
|
if (i == axis) {
|
|
sizes.push_back(0);
|
|
} else {
|
|
sizes.push_back(outputShape[i]);
|
|
}
|
|
strides.push_back(1);
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
// these are not used, but they are required
|
|
// for the creation of InsertSliceOp operation
|
|
auto dynamicOffsets = llvm::ArrayRef<mlir::Value>{};
|
|
auto dynamicSizes = llvm::ArrayRef<mlir::Value>{};
|
|
auto dynamicStrides = llvm::ArrayRef<mlir::Value>{};
|
|
|
|
for (mlir::Value input : op.getOperands()) {
|
|
auto inputType = input.getType().dyn_cast<mlir::TensorType>();
|
|
int64_t axisSize = inputType.getShape()[axis];
|
|
|
|
// offsets and sizes will be modified for each input tensor
|
|
// if we have:
|
|
// "FHELinalg.concat"(%x, %y, %z) :
|
|
// (
|
|
// tensor<3x!FHE.eint<7>>,
|
|
// tensor<4x!FHE.eint<7>>,
|
|
// tensor<2x!FHE.eint<7>>,
|
|
// )
|
|
// -> tensor<9x!FHE.eint<7>>
|
|
//
|
|
// for the first copy:
|
|
// offsets = [0], sizes = [3], strides = [1]
|
|
//
|
|
// for the second copy:
|
|
// offsets = [3], sizes = [4], strides = [1]
|
|
//
|
|
// for the third copy:
|
|
// offsets = [7], sizes = [2], strides = [1]
|
|
//
|
|
// so in each iteration:
|
|
// - the size is set to the axis size of the input
|
|
// - the offset is increased by the size of the previous input
|
|
|
|
sizes[axis] = axisSize;
|
|
|
|
// these arrays are copied, so it's fine to modify and use them again
|
|
mlir::ArrayAttr offsetsAttr = rewriter.getI64ArrayAttr(offsets);
|
|
mlir::ArrayAttr sizesAttr = rewriter.getI64ArrayAttr(sizes);
|
|
mlir::ArrayAttr stridesAttr = rewriter.getI64ArrayAttr(strides);
|
|
|
|
offsets[axis] += axisSize;
|
|
|
|
result = rewriter
|
|
.create<mlir::tensor::InsertSliceOp>(
|
|
location, outputType, input, result, dynamicOffsets,
|
|
dynamicSizes, dynamicStrides, offsetsAttr, sizesAttr,
|
|
stridesAttr)
|
|
.getResult();
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
rewriter.replaceOp(op, {result});
|
|
return mlir::success();
|
|
};
|
|
};
